Transaction ad7aab25930aafead86386bcf8e9e5e1529f153a38c18fd4f6f8a8c93a0d5bb0
1 Input
1 Output
-
ad7aab25930aafead86386bcf8e9e5e1529f153a38c18fd4f6f8a8c93a0d5bb0:0
- value
- 66905
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ec4f41363ca6f77984691ea1429e21d9ac81312d OP_EQUAL
- address
- 3PEWLXm96oX6zpzn7TwHegwfb3NPMmXhP5